Tana-Andasibe National Park

Day 2

Tana-Andasibe National Park

After breakfast, departure by road towards Andasibe-Mantadia National Park, located in Madagascar’s eastern rainforest region. The drive takes approximately 4 to 5 hours through scenic highland landscapes, traditional villages, waterfalls, and eucalyptus forests before reaching the lush tropical rainforest of Andasibe. Upon arrival and check-in at your lodge, an afternoon visit of the Analamazaotra Special Reserve will introduce you to Madagascar’s unique rainforest ecosystem. The reserve is especially famous for the Indri Indri, the largest living lemur species, known for its haunting calls echoing through the forest. In the evening, a guided nocturnal walk offers the opportunity to discover Madagascar’s fascinating nocturnal wildlife including mouse lemurs, leaf-tailed geckos, frogs, and sleeping chameleons hidden among the vegetation. Andasibe National Park

Day 3

Andasibe National Park

Today is fully dedicated to the exploration of Andasibe-Mantadia National Park, one of Madagascar’s most famous wildlife destinations. Accompanied by a specialist local guide, you will walk through the dense rainforest searching for lemurs including Indri Indri, common brown lemurs, bamboo lemurs, and possibly diademed sifakas. The forest is also exceptionally rich in endemic birds, reptiles, amphibians, orchids, and medicinal plants. The rainforest atmosphere, giant tree ferns, moss-covered trees, and constant sounds of wildlife make Andasibe one of the most rewarding nature experiences in Madagascar. Andasibe-Tana

Day 4

Andasibe-Tana

After breakfast, departure for a visit to Maromizaha Reserve, a remarkable primary rainforest reserve located close to Andasibe. Less visited than the main national park, Maromizaha offers a more intimate and authentic rainforest experience with outstanding biodiversity. The reserve is highly appreciated by wildlife enthusiasts and researchers due to its excellent concentration of endemic species. During your guided walk, you may encounter several species of lemurs, endemic birds, frogs, and reptiles while exploring pristine rainforest crossed by streams and covered with lush vegetation. Fly to Antsiranana-Montagne d'Ambre

Day 5

Fly to Antsiranana-Montagne d'Ambre

Early transfer to the airport for your domestic flight to Antsiranana (Diego Suarez), located in the far north of Madagascar. Upon arrival, departure directly towards Montagne d’Ambre National Park. This beautiful volcanic rainforest park is known for its cool climate, waterfalls, crater lakes, and exceptional biodiversity. During your guided walk through the rainforest, you may encounter crowned lemurs, Sanford’s brown lemurs, colorful chameleons, geckos, endemic birds, and many unique plant species. The dense tropical forest and volcanic scenery provide a striking contrast to the dry landscapes of northern Madagascar surrounding the massif. Driving time: approximately 1.5 hours from the airport. Ankarana National Park

Day 7

Ankarana National Park

Full day dedicated to the exploration of Ankarana National Park, one of Madagascar’s most spectacular geological reserves. The park is famous for its tsingy formations — dramatic limestone pinnacles creating a labyrinth of sharp rocks, caves, canyons, underground rivers, and dry forests. Guided hikes through the reserve offer opportunities to discover crowned lemurs, Sanford’s brown lemurs, bats, reptiles, and numerous endemic birds. Several viewpoints and suspension bridges provide breathtaking panoramic scenery over the limestone massif and surrounding forest. Ankarana-Nosy Be

Day 8

Ankarana-Nosy Be

After breakfast, departure by road towards Ankify, the seaport connecting mainland Madagascar to the island of Nosy Be. The drive passes through dry forests, cocoa plantations, ylang-ylang plantations, and tropical landscapes typical of the Sambirano region. Upon arrival at Ankify, transfer by speedboat to Nosy Be. Nosy Be is Madagascar’s most famous island destination, known for its tropical beaches, turquoise waters, coral reefs, and relaxed atmosphere. Arrival and transfer to your beachfront hotel. Nosy Be

Day 9

Nosy Be

These three days are dedicated to relaxation and discovery on the tropical island of Nosy Be, Madagascar’s most famous beach destination. Surrounded by turquoise waters and beautiful beaches, Nosy Be offers the perfect conclusion to your Madagascar adventure after exploring the country’s rainforests and national parks. During your stay, you may simply relax by the beach and enjoy the peaceful island atmosphere or participate in a variety of optional excursions and activities. Popular activities include snorkeling and diving among colorful coral reefs, island hopping excursions to nearby islands such as Nosy Komba and Nosy Tanikely, whale shark excursions depending on the season, sunset cruises, or visits to tropical plantations and local markets. Nosy Be is also known for its warm climate, spectacular sunsets, rich marine biodiversity, and relaxed ambiance, making it an ideal destination for both adventure and relaxation.
